Мне нужно создать FTP-сервер, доступ к которому можно получить через Интернет; с кучей места. В настоящее время у меня есть компьютер, который я собираюсь использовать, хотя, если он не будет признан достаточно хорошим для использования, я куплю новый компьютер специально для этой цели. Проблема, однако, в том, что я ничего не знаю о том, как настроить FTP-сервер, или, если на то пошло, что требуется в системе для этого.

Компьютер, который я собирался использовать, - это настольный компьютер HP с загруженной 3 ГБ, Windows Media Home Edition, 200 ГБ, внутреннее хранилище (будет обновлено массивом RAID 0 с 6x дисками IDE различного размера), 620 Вт, блок питания, 240 МБ (я думаю), встроенный графический процессор NVidia (также, вероятно, будет обновлен) и четырехъядерный 64-битный процессор AMD (не забывайте точную модель). Вероятно, я бы обновил операционную систему до Windows 7, при условии, что она будет наиболее эффективной при создании FTP-сервера.

У меня есть коммутатор HP Procurve 4000M Ethernet (http://community.moertel.com/~thor/pix/20051111-procurve/img_0856-wm.jpg), который я, скорее всего, буду использовать для подключения компьютера FTP-сервера к моей домашней сети как ну как интернет. Имейте в виду, что я не совсем уверен, что буду использовать этот переключатель, так как, несмотря на работоспособность устройства, он требует большой мощности, а также издает много шума из-за массивного массива вентиляторов внутри устройства, и я не уверен, что другие, живущие в моем доме, оценят шум 24/7.

Основной целью FTP-сервера будет обмен файлами с членами моей компании. Мы являемся независимой группой разработчиков игр. До сих пор мы использовали Google Drive и Dropbox для наших файлов, но необходимость в FTP-сервере возникла, когда A) нам не хватило места, которое мы могли бы себе позволить на Google Drive, а также что B) ни один из сетевых дисков и платные услуги FTP предоставили нам достаточно преференций. Файлы, которые будут храниться на сервере, могут отличаться от небольших.Документы TXT чрезвычайно велики.Файлы C4D и другие очень большие типы файлов (такие как фотошоп.Файлы PSB, библиотеки текстур и т.д.). Имейте в виду, что люди, которые будут получать доступ к этому серверу, будут в основном получать доступ к нему через Интернет.

У меня есть огромное количество знаний о том, как создавать компьютеры, устанавливать операционные системы и т.д., Поэтому я могу делать практически все, что может потребоваться для настройки этого FTP-сервера.

3 ответа3

5
  1. Пожалуйста, не используйте XP. XP почти не поддерживается, и вам придется отказаться от него менее чем за год. (win7, бесплатный дистрибутив Linux, BSD, сервер Windows, ... все в порядке. Просто не используйте XP.)
  2. Я надеюсь, вы понимаете, что FTP не является безопасным. Если каждый не может загрузить анонимно, пожалуйста, рассмотрите что-то еще (например, sFTP, обратите внимание на s)
  3. Для сервера FTP графический процессор не требуется. Зачем оставлять это в этих постоянно использующих силу?
  4. Насколько хорош ваш домашний интернет? И скачать и загрузить. (С DSK или кабелем загрузка часто очень медленная).
  5. Как создаются резервные копии. Они хранятся вне сайта?

...

Я мог бы продолжить, но вы ищете настройку файлового сервера в офисе и пытаетесь сделать это с древней ОС, на неподходящем рабочем столе, вероятно, подключенном к некоммерческой сети. Вероятно, возникнут проблемы.

Я понимаю, что инди игры Dev. может не иметь всех ресурсов крупных фирм, но наем кого-то, кто сделает это для вас, может быть довольно рентабельным в долгосрочной перспективе.

2

Ну, я на самом деле согласен со всеми ответами, которые уже даны (особенно без использования XP - даже MS говорит, что это плохо с безопасностью). Я просто хотел бы добавить альтернативное решение для вашего рассмотрения.

Вы можете приобрести Raspberry PI дешево, подключить достойный USB-концентратор и подключить внешние приводы. Простая настройка Raspbian для размещения FTP-сервера (или sftp, что было бы лучше), и все готово. Низкое энергопотребление, и если вам нужно больше места, просто подключите другой диск и создайте символические ссылки, чтобы он выглядел как один диск.

Вам не нужна приличная машина для хостинга FTP, машина предназначена для аутентификации, тогда речь идет в основном о скорости линии.

Из вашего поста видно, что вы более знакомы с Windows, чем с Linux, но настроить что-то столь же простое, как ftp-сервер в Linux, легко, более того, вы можете изменить порт ftp на 80, чтобы получить наименьшее регулирование от ваш интернет-провайдер (и поверьте мне, все будут задушены, независимо от того, что рекламирует ваш интернет-провайдер).

1

То, что Hennes на 100% правильно, никогда не будет хорошей идеей использовать ваш компьютер в качестве сервера.

Если у вас действительно нет денег, чтобы купить тарифный план, рассмотрите возможность использования 000webhost.com или какой-либо другой бесплатной услуги хостинга, эти услуги не очень хороши, но вы получаете то, за что платите, а вы нет платить что угодно.

Зарегистрируйте домен .tk, который также бесплатный, и есть много бесплатных провайдеров доменных имен. Настройте все, и вы готовы к работе.

Если вы хотите настроить свой собственный сервер и установить ftp-сервер, то, как установить proftpd на centos, вам может потребоваться следовать другому руководству в зависимости от вашей ОС.

Я никогда не использую FTP, он небезопасен, и его безопасность вызывает головную боль. Зачем его настраивать, когда я могу просто использовать SFTP?

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.